Review (Update): Vevor 3000W 24VDC to 120VAC Pure Sine Wave Inverter

Posted on May 27, 2024

Important update: I installed this inverter a little over a year ago and all was well until early last week.

All of a sudden the inverter started beeping and shutting down at random times. A quick check revealed that the fan had stopped operating, causing the unit to over-heat.

This was quite unexpected because, as I mentioned in the initial review, the device had always remained cool to the touch and the fan rarely turned on at all during normal operation.

Long story short, this device developed a serious issue shortly after the warranty had expired. For that reason, I can no longer recommend it since it failed even though it was never forced to operate under a heavy load.
